In January, the group will discuss “The Book of Joy” by the Dalai Lama and Archbishop Desmond Tutu.  These two holy men have survived more than fifty years of exile and the soul-crushing violence of oppression. Despite their hardships — or, as they would say, because of them — they are two of the most joyful people on the planet.  With this book they answer the question: How do we find joy in the face of life’s inevitable suffering?  This month’s book club is facilitated by Rev.
